Topkaya on death fast: Those who remain silence in the face of this tyranny is an accomplice

img

DİYARBAKIR - Ahmet Topkaya who is on a death fast for 18 days in Diyarbakır Type D Prison, emphasizing that isolation is everybody's problem, said: "You can't live in peace with tyranny. Those who remain silence in the face of tyranny, is an accomplice."

 
The letter Topkaya sent to e-rojname is as follows: 
 
"I am sending my love to you all in the name of all my resisting comrades. We commemorate the sons and daughters of the valiant people who lost their lives for a free and prosperous Kurdistan, and want for all to know that we will claim their memories at all costs. The purpose of our calls is to make everyone understand our death fast.
 
Isolation is not the problem of our mothers who got beaten and insulted at the prison gates alone. It is the problem of all those who define themselves socialists, democrats, leftists. Isolation undermines the will of millions of people and nullifies them.The continuation of the isolation means the annihilation of the common democratic values. Remainin unresponsive to the isolation means to legitimize the massacres and oppression thoughout the history of the republic. You can't live in peace with tyranny. Those who remain silence in the face of tyranny, is an accomplice.
 
 
 
We have unfinished business with those who deemed tears proper for our mothers on the mothers day. The youth of Kurdistan have and will call them to account.In the past, the Kurdish youth did not succumb to fascism, and today it will not be subdued. Surely resistance will determine the final result. How in Kobane, Cizre, Sur were won with resistance, the name of the victory today is resistance. Our people today ordered us to assume a historic responsibility. We will fulfill our duty with historical responsibility.
